As a new material, nanocellulose has excellent mechanical properties and environmental protection characteristics and is gradually being used in the production of plywood. The application of nanocellulose in plywood is mainly manifested in the following aspects:
1. Enhanced performance : Nanocellulose can be added as a reinforcement to the adhesive of plywood to improve the mechanical properties of plywood, such as strength and durability. The high strength and high modulus properties of nanocellulose enable it to significantly improve the flexural strength, compressive strength, etc. of plywood.
2. Improve adhesion : The nanocellulose has a large surface area and high chemical activity. It can form a good combination with adhesives and wood fibers, enhance the adhesion of plywood and interlayer bonding strength, thereby reducing the plywood during use. stratification phenomenon.
3. Environmental protection performance : Compared with traditional chemical reinforcers, nanocellulose is a natural material that is harmless to the environment. The use of nanocellulose in plywood production can reduce the use of chemicals and reduce the release of harmful substances (such as formaldehyde), and meet modern environmental protection requirements.
4. Reduce material usage : Because nanocellulose has excellent reinforcement effect, it can reduce the use of traditional materials (such as adhesives and wood) in plywood production, thereby reducing production costs and improving product cost performance.
In general, the introduction of nanocellulose not only improves the performance of plywood, but also conforms to the trend of sustainable development. In the future, with the further maturity of nanocellulose production technology and the reduction of costs, its application prospects in plywood production will become more extensive.
